The Site Is a Black Hole
Every single request to bertogden.com — homepage, robots.txt, llms.txt, sitemap.xml — returns HTTP 403 from Cloudflare. No AI crawler, no browser, no tool can access a single byte of content. The site has zero visible text, zero schema, zero headings, zero internal links. It is functionally invisible to the internet.
Crawler Access
All eleven tested user-agents — GPTBot, ClaudeBot, PerplexityBot, Google-Extended, OAI-SearchBot, Applebot-Extended, ChatGPT-User, Bytespider, anthropic-ai, Perplexity-User, and a standard Browser — receive identical 403 responses. The robots.txt and llms.txt endpoints also return 403, meaning no crawler can even discover access rules. The domain resolves to a Cloudflare-protected server at 54.243.57.127, and www.bertogden.com is a CNAME to pod28.dealerinspire.com, a dealership CMS platform. The site is behind a Cloudflare WAF that blocks all traffic indiscriminately.

Schema Posture
The homepage contains zero JSON-LD, zero structured data of any kind. No AutoDealer, Organization, LocalBusiness, or Product schema exists. Combined with the 403 wall, this means no search engine or AI crawler can extract entity relationships, inventory, location, or contact information from the site.
